People keep asking me about the acronyms I use, and what they stand for. Apparently there are people out there that aren’t involved in the writing world at all. (GASP!) 🙂 So, for all of you who live in the “normal” world, here is a list of common acronyms used by writers. (If there are any I missed, please comment below).
WIP = Work in Progress
ARC = Advanced Reader’s Copy
POV = Point of view (If there is a 1st, 3rd . . . just means which POV…first person, third person)
SASE = self addressed stamped envelope
CP = Critique Partner
WM = Writer’s Market
MS = Manuscript
MSS = Manuscripts
MC = Main Character
SS = Simultaneous Submission
HEA = Happily Ever After
WB = Writer’s Block
BIC = Butt in chairÂ
